Down to business. im looking at 18x8.5's (which are sized to fit) and looking at a 275/35/18 on the rear and a 245/40/18 on the front? out side of possible oversteer and a crappy ride any other laws of physics that im going to be breaking unknowingly??
Also, correct me if im wrong but if a 275/40/17 (25.66 diameter) fits without rubbing on the car, then a 275/30/18 (25.7 diameter) SHOULD clear if i have no rubbing, at full lock rubbing is alright to me, being if im at full lock at speed im about to die anyways. So anyone with 18's help me out

You are correct about the 275's in the front. With actual sizes (wheel and tire) matched up you will have the same results. Should work providing the fronts have the correct offset/backspacing. Another thing to keep is mind is your stance. What kind of drop do you have? One thing I'm not sure of is tire sizes for those wheel sizes. Not sure if a 275/35/18 will fit on a 18x8.5. When you run less sidewall, the fitments become less forgiving as far as width. Check the tire manufacturers and if they say it'll fit then go for it.
